    Common technical challenges and solutions when using ISPLSI 2064VE-135LT44


    ISPLSI 2064VE-135LT44 is a complex programmable logic device (CPLD) commonly used in embedded systems for various applications. It offers versatile functionality, high integration, and low power consumption.

    Technical Challenges:

    When using ISPLSI 2064VE-135LT44, several technical challenges may arise, including:

    1. Noise Issues: Due to the high integration and complexity of designs, noise interference can affect signal integrity, leading to errors or malfunctions in the system.

    2. Power Consumption: Efficient power management is crucial to ensure optimal performance and extend the battery life of devices utilizing ISPLSI 2064VE-135LT44.

    3. Integration Complexity: As designs become more intricate, managing the integration of various components and functionalities within the ISPLSI 2064VE-135LT44 can be challenging.

    Solutions and Improvements:

    To address these challenges, consider the following solutions and improvements:

    1. Noise Mitigation Techniques: Implement shielding, filtering, and proper grounding techniques to reduce noise interference. Use differential signaling where applicable and carefully layout the PCB to minimize signal crosstalk.

    2. Power Optimization: Utilize low-power design techniques such as clock gating, power gating, and voltage scaling to reduce power consumption. Optimize the CPLD configuration to minimize dynamic power usage during operation.

    3. Design Partitioning: Divide the system into smaller modules and utilize hierarchical design methodologies to manage the complexity of integration. Implement clear communication protocols and interfaces between modules to facilitate seamless integration.

    4. Simulation and Verification: Perform thorough simulation and verification tests using tools like ModelSim or Mentor Graphics to identify and resolve potential issues early in the design phase. Verify the system's functionality and performance under various operating conditions.

    5. Firmware Optimization: Optimize firmware algorithms to minimize resource utilization and maximize performance. Utilize parallel processing and efficient coding practices to enhance the efficiency of the ISPLSI 2064VE-135LT44 implementation.

    6. Thermal Management: Implement effective thermal management techniques such as heat sinks, thermal vias, and airflow optimization to prevent overheating and ensure reliable operation of the ISPLSI 2064VE-135LT44.

    7. Documentation and Knowledge Sharing: Maintain comprehensive documentation of the design process, including design specifications, test plans, and implementation details. Encourage knowledge sharing among team members to leverage collective expertise and address technical challenges effectively.
